Photogene for iPhone and iPad gets a major update

Omer Shoor's very popular Photogene app has just received another major update. This time both the iPhone and iPad versions gain a number of new and improved features, which include…

  • Device-to-device: transfer photos directly to another iPad/iPhone (requires Photogene to be installed on the other device).
  • Clarity slider. 
  • Clone tool. 
  • Create your own presets! Long tap on a photo in the editor to save it as a preset.
  • Add date-stamp to your exported photos. 
  • Copy edit operations from one photo and apply the same edits on another photo. Long tap on a photo in the editor to bring up the copy&paste menu. 
  • Can now upload directly to Evernote and Tumblr. 
  • Now it's possible to preserve the original file names when uploading to Dropbox, FTP or mail (requires iOS 5).

In addition, US customers can now order tap2print real photo products from directly from Photogene, that are then delivered by mail.
